WebBecause the water content of serum and plasma (~92% w/w) is higher than in an equal volume of blood (~80% w/w), the concentrations of ethanol will also be higher. Direct measurements have shown that the average distribution ratio for ethanol between serum (plasma) and whole blood is 1.15:1, with a range from 1.10:1 to 1.20:1 ( Charlebois et al ... WebA BAC of 0.10 by mass(0.10%) is 0.10 g of alcohol per 100 g of blood (23 mmol/L). A BAC of 0.0 is sober; in different countries the maximum permitted BAC when driving ranges from about 0.02% to 0.08%; BAC levels over 0.08% are considered impaired; above 0.40% is potentially fatal. WebJun 3, 2024 · BAC 0.13 – 0.16. At this level of alcohol in blood, the individual is very drunk with severe impairment of major motor skills, perception, and judgment. The reaction time is prolonged, the speech is slurred, and vision is blurred. BAC 0.17 – 0.19. Most drinkers will start to feel incapacitated, and some will pass out.
